Kodri Population - Balrampur, Uttar Pradesh

Kodri is a large village located in Tulsipur Tehsil of Balrampur district, Uttar Pradesh with total 250 families residing. The Kodri village has population of 2021 of which 1022 are males while 999 are females as per Population Census 2011.

In Kodri village population of children with age 0-6 is 398 which makes up 19.69 % of total population of village. Average Sex Ratio of Kodri village is 977 which is higher than Uttar Pradesh state average of 912. Child Sex Ratio for the Kodri as per census is 801, lower than Uttar Pradesh average of 902.

Kodri village has lower literacy rate compared to Uttar Pradesh. In 2011, literacy rate of Kodri village was 46.21 % compared to 67.68 % of Uttar Pradesh. In Kodri Male literacy stands at 51.81 % while female literacy rate was 40.75 %.

Caste Factor

Schedule Caste (SC) constitutes 14.25 % of total population in Kodri village. The village Kodri currently doesn’t have any Schedule Tribe (ST) population.

Work Profile

In Kodri village out of total population, 1081 were engaged in work activities. 53.28 % of workers describe their work as Main Work (Employment or Earning more than 6 Months) while 46.72 % were involved in Marginal activity providing livelihood for less than 6 months. Of 1081 workers engaged in Main Work, 358 were cultivators (owner or co-owner) while 166 were Agricultural labourer.
